BACKGROUND
SEBI has notified the amendments to the SEBI (Listing and Disclosure Requirements) Regulations, 2015 (LODR Regulations) vide notification dated 14th June, 2023. Except where specified, they will come into effect from the 30th day from the date of their publication in the Official Gazette. Thus, a short period has been given so that the amendments are understood and digested and systems laid down for their implementation. The amendments relate generally to what one would call corporate governance requirements. Some of the amendments made are substantial in nature with far reaching effects. Importantly, an effectively retrospective application has been given to some amendments since they will apply also to subsisting arrangements and situations. Listed companies, their key management personnel, directors and others concerned will need to study and examine which of them apply to their companies and lay down processes to implement them. These amendments follow the Consultation Paper issued on 21st February, 2023 and considering the feedback received to this paper, SEBI has implemented the proposals in a manner that is different in some aspects of what the original proposals laid down.
